With more than two decades international experience and a highly successful Auckland café under his belt, Merouane Rahal hopes to inspire NMIT students to see “the world is your oyster”.

Merouane Rahal qualified as a chef in France at the age of 20 before venturing across Europe, picking up the continent’s diverse flavours and food traditions along the way.

He lived in London for five years where he worked alongside Michelin Star chefs before immigrating to New Zealand and settling in Auckland.

It was there that he and his sister opened a café, Voila, and created an innovative, standout menu inspired by their French/Algerian roots.

Voila featured on Metro Magazine’s coveted Top 50 Auckland Cafés list for six years and was also on TVNZ’s Taste of New Zealand show.

Merouane sold Voila “at its peak” and made the move to teaching, starting as a cookery tutor at Whitireia in Auckland.

In 2018, he took up a position as a Culinary Arts tutor at NMIT where students benefit from his extensive restaurant, café, and business experience.

“I focus a lot on self-development by enhancing confidence, teamwork, respect, creativity and passing on a passion for food to students.”
